2012 Châteauneuf-du-Pape Horizontal (San Diego, CA): Over ripe strawberries, over ripe black cherries,over ripe raspberries, smoked wood and rose petals on the nose. It smells a little extracted and concentrated, with a high intensity of aromas. The palate adds dark chocolate, allspice, tobacco, Kirschwasser and bitter herbs. This really tastes like chocolate covered cherries more than anything else. Medium + intensity of flavors. This wine feels well made and ticks all the boxes most want in a 11 year old CdP. If anything, it's a tad boring. Driven by fruit and oak, it's missing some of the non-fruit notes I really like in older CdP.
Medium + body with medium acid, medium - tannin and a medium finish. The 15% alcohol is pretty well hidden here. Maybe there's a slight burn when drinking it; but it's quite smooth given the ABV. Can drink now or age 2-5 more years in the bottle.

Initially a really strong gamey note on the nose, but this fell to the background with time as dark berries & floral elements came to the fore. Full bodied, medium acidity and still some medium tannic grip. Long & complex, with some spices in the finish.
I was worried about the alcohol level of this wine. I could smell the alcohol, but surprisingly I didn't feel any heat. However, I could feel the alcohol affect me over the night much more than half a bottle of wine typically does. I liked this overall but I'm not sure I'd want to have too many glasses of this on one night. I'll be curious to see how this compares to the 2014 which has only 14% ABV.
This cost about £60, which feels about right. I'd question the QPR at 139,90€ as Forceberry mentions below.
